WebOct 21, 2024 · The majority of adoptive families do not consist of just one adopted child and the adoptive parents 1 – but we often treat them as such. Almost all treatments and interventions for adoptive families are focused exclusively on the needs of the adopted child. I became a post-adoption therapist to help children similar to my own siblings.
